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
500 426244 473 814862
88527610 05724542 37369559
88527610 05724542 37369559
75652304 9657 0108999
All about undefined
Interested in learning more?
88527610 05724542 37369559
75652304 9657 0108999
See more
191 5572722730
3786 4081 0140533 2532 33165564
See more
6059205801 88990 64080286
20573922 60 71
See more